passwordsafe: Simple & Secure Password Management

 Password Safe allows you to safely and easily create a secured and
 encrypted user name/password list. With Password Safe all you have to do
 is create and remember a single "Master Password" of your choice in order
 to unlock and access your entire user name/password list.
 .
 This is the GNU/Linux version of the popular PasswordSafe password
 manager, originally designed by the renowned security technologist
 Bruce Schneier and open sourced in 2002.
 .
 Compatible with 1.x, 2.x and 3.x versions of the database format.
 .
 Note: This is a BETA release for Linux, therefore some functionality
 may not yet be implemented.
